One of the UTM founders of Kuwala Youth Network Secretary, Rasool Jackson has become the latest member to tender his resignation letter from the party with immediate effect.
The first one to throw a towel was Kalindo aka Winiko who resigned from his position as National UTM Director of Youth.
In a letter dated March 15, 2022 addressed to UTMs Secretary General, Patricia Kaliati, says Jackson as party member who advances message of change, hope for Malawi wokomela tonse.
Jackson feels pity for what is happening in the country now.
Jackson observes that life has become too tough to Malawians due to current ill-economic situation the country is sailing through where prices of essential goods like cooking oil, sugar, bread, soap are being hiked on daily basis.
“I, therefore, tender my resignation both as UTMs Kuwala Youth Network Secretary and member of UTM with immediate effect,’’ reads Jackson’s letter.
He has wished the party’s leadership well asking Chilima “To remember that it is the people that put him where he is today and one day he shall have a say, he will need them most”.
Jackson adds; “The public will be informed on his next political journey but for the meantime, he will concentrate much on his personal errands”.
